How much do aide tank installer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for aide tank installer in the United States is $22.63,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.55 and $25.72 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Seeking a Mechanical Technician to complete our custom generator enclosures $3,000 SIGN ON BONUS! 20% SHIFT PREMIUM
EK is looking for a full-time mechanical tech ready to work hard and put their manufacturing and assembling skills to use in a fast-paced and friendly environment. Our new team members will work with our experienced team to complete assembly of generator enclosures, tanks, and their subassemblies using blueprints and other written and verbal specifications.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
Reads and understands blueprints and bill of material.
  • Operates pipe threader and cutting devices to manufacture sub-assembly parts to print.
  • Installs mechanical assemblies onto generator engines and fuel tanks.
  • Assembles functional parts of enclosures and tanks using hand tools, power tools (cordless drills, impact gun, etc.) levels, plumb bobs, and straight edges.
  • Inspects parts using precision measuring equipment and documents inspection data.
  • Uses forklifts, aerial lifts, cranes, ladders and other lifting apparatus to aide in the assembly process.
  • Assists in the assembly and installation of electrical and electronic components (electrical enclosures, transformers, etc. all electrical connections are done by qualified personnel), pipe systems and plumbing, machinery and equipment.
  • Assembles both small and large sub-assemblies according to prints or drawings.
  • Reads bill of material to package parts/kits to customer requirements.
  • Studies blueprints, sketches, drawings, manuals, specifications, or sample parts to determine assembly sequence, and setup requirements.
  • Follows work instructions from general description. Works with other team members to troubleshoot mechanical/fit issues in a satisfactory manner.
  • Ensures punch lists are complete.
  • Aides in preparation and disassembly of factory witness tests.
  • Prepares generator packages for shipment.
  • Loads generator enclosures and fuel tanks.
  • Keeps work area clean and organized.
